Image: Malignaggi looks to take the WBA title from SenchenkoBy Jason Kim: Paulie Malignaggi (30-4, 6 KO’s) says he has the perfect strategy to beat WBA World welterweight champion Vyacheslav Senchenko on April 29th. Malignaggi is going to have to find a way past Senchenko’s long reach and powerful jab, because he’s not going to open up holes for Malignaggi to punch through by looking to over-commit to his punches by looking to slug with Malignaggi.

Senchenko isn’t that kind of a fighter. He’s more of a technical type of fighter that looks to keep the action on the outside where he can control the pace and not get hit. As far as I can tell, Senchenko has no real inside game. I’ve seen him briefly attempt to fight on the inside, but it generally turned into clinch after a few half-hearted punch attempts by Senchenko. That good thing that Senchenko has going for him is that Malignaggi doesn’t have an inside game either, so he’s not likely to try and fight Senchenko in close.

What Malignaggi will likely be doing is what he’s always done in the past by circling with his hands down by his side, trying to get Senchenko to nail him with power shots. Malignaggi is usually able to get his opponents to try and hit him, and from there he lands his counter punches. Malignaggi doesn’t do well when his opponents opt to jab him from the outside instead of slug. We saw this with Malignaggi’s losses to Amir Khan and Miguel Cotto in the past. Those two decided not to take the bait and just look to slug against a moving target like Malignaggi. They were smart to keep jabbing Malignaggi without falling for his tricks. Senchenko is a disciplined fighter and he won’t be looking to slug it out with Malignaggi until he’s tenderized him first with his jab.

Malignaggi says he has one big strategy that he says will work against Senchenko, but if it doesn’t he says he has a great backup plan to beat him. My guess is the first strategy will be for Malignaggi to use the circular movement to try and lure Senchenko into slugging. If that doesn’t work, Malignaggi will likely attack him in an all out assault.

Senchenko will easily pick off Malignaggi if he comes unglued and tries to make an assault. That won’t work, as Senchenko’s jabs and movement will keep him from getting hit with much of what Malignaggi throws.
